Tooth sensitivity takes place when the underlying layer of your teeth, called dentin, ends up being revealed. This commonly happens when your enamel wears down or when your gum tissues decline. The dentin contains microscopic tubules that lead straight to the control center of your tooth. When these tubules are exposed to temperature adjustments, sweet or acidic foods, or perhaps air, you experience that sharp, uncomfortable feeling that makes you wince.

Comprehending the Root Causes of Tooth Sensitivity



Before you can effectively manage tooth level of sensitivity throughout rainy season, you require to understand what triggers it in the first place. Enamel disintegration places as one of the key offenders. Your enamel acts as the safety outer shell of your teeth, yet it can gradually wear off because of acidic foods and beverages, aggressive brushing, or teeth grinding.



Periodontal economic crisis represents another typical reason. When your gums draw back from your teeth, they subject the origin surface areas, which do not have the protective enamel covering. This condition can result from periodontal illness, severe brushing methods, or merely hereditary elements. Tooth decay, also in its onset, can trigger sensitivity. Dental caries develop openings that enable stimulations to reach the nerve extra conveniently. Recent dental job, such as obtaining dental crowns in Seminole procedures completed, could additionally trigger short-term level of sensitivity as your teeth adjust to the repair. Practical Strategies for Managing Sensitivity During Humid Months



Taking care of tooth level of sensitivity throughout Seminole's stormy period calls for a diverse technique that resolves both instant discomfort and long-term defense. Begin by assessing your everyday dental hygiene routine. Switch over to a soft-bristled tooth brush if you haven't currently, and utilize mild round motions as opposed to aggressive back-and-forth scrubbing up. Lots of people brush also hard without understanding it, progressively wearing off enamel and irritating periodontal tissue.



Desensitizing toothpaste can offer considerable relief when made use of constantly. These specialized formulas consist of compounds that aid obstruct the tubules in your dentin, reducing the transmission of feelings to the nerve. Use the tooth paste as directed, and consider leaving a small amount on specifically delicate locations for a few mins prior to rinsing. Results usually appear after numerous days of routine use.



Take note of your diet regimen throughout the humid months. Limit acidic foods and beverages such as citrus fruits, tomatoes, marinaded items, and sodas. When you do consume these items, rinse your mouth with water afterward, however wait at the very least half an hour before brushing to avoid scrubbing acid into your enamel. The waiting period enables your saliva to normally remineralize your teeth.



Think about using a fluoride mouth rinse daily to enhance your enamel. Fluoride assists restore damaged enamel and can minimize sensitivity over time. You can find these rinses at any kind of pharmacy in Seminole, from the Walgreens on Seminole Boulevard to the CVS near Walsingham Road.

Recognizing When to Seek Immediate Care



While many tooth level of sensitivity can be taken care of with preventative treatment and home therapies, specific signs require prompt professional focus. Sharp, severe pain that lasts greater than a few seconds after direct exposure to a trigger could indicate a cracked tooth or deep degeneration. Sensitivity concentrated in one particular tooth rather than multiple teeth commonly signifies a problem that requires medical diagnosis and therapy.



If you notice swelling, persistent halitosis, or bleeding periodontals in addition to the original source level of sensitivity, these signs and symptoms could show gum tissue disease or infection. Do not ignore prolonged pain that hinders eating, drinking, or your daily tasks. What begins as convenient sensitivity can progress into even more serious dental issues if left unaddressed.
